Where does “ną̊l” come from?

ną̊l (Elfdalian) comes from Old Norse nál, from Proto-Germanic nēþlō, from Proto-Indo-European (s)neh₁- — to spin (thread), to sew.

ną̊l (Elfdalian): needle
